Black Mask 2: City of Masks is a 2002 Hong Kong action film directed by Tsui Hark. It stars Tobin Bell, Jon Polito, Teresa Herrera, Tyler Mane, Rob Van Dam and Andy On. Traci Lords (credited as Traci Elizabeh Lords) appears in the film as Chameleon.

The Black Mask must stop a group intent on setting off a DNA bomb that could cause mutations to the human race.